1、MCS51 单片机引脚功能简介MCS-51 系列单片机产品有 8051,8031 ,8751,80C51,80C31 等型号(前三种为 CMOS 芯片,后两种为 CHMOS 芯片)。它们的结构基本相同,其主要差别反映在存储器的配置上。8051 内部设有 4K 字节的掩模 ROM 程序存储器,8031 片内没有程序存储器,而 8751 是将 8051 片内的 ROM 换成EPROM。由 ATMEL 公司生产的 89C51 将 EPROM 改成了 4K 的闪速存储器。 MCS-51 单片机是在一块芯片中集成了 CPU,RAM,ROM、定时器/计数器和多种功能的 I/O 线等一台计算机所需要的基本功
2、能部件。MCS-51 单片机内包含下列几个部件: 一个 8 位 CPU; 一个片内振荡器及时钟电路; 4K 字节 ROM 程序存储器; 128 字节 RAM 数据存储器; 两个 16 位定时器/计数器; 可寻址 64KB 外部数据存储器和 64BK 外部程序存储器空间的控制电路; 32 条可编程的 I/O 线(四个 8 位并行 I/O 端口); 一个可编程全双工串行口; 具有五个中断源、两个优先级嵌套中断结构。MCS-51 单片机内部结构图MCS-51 单片机引脚功能:MCS-51 单片机引脚图1 电源线:VCC:+5 V 电源。VSS:地线。 2 RST:复位信号线。当输入的复位信号延续两个
3、机器周期以上的高电平时即为有效,用以完成单片机的复位初始化操作。3 信号引脚介绍 P0.0 P0.7: P0 口 8 位双向口线。 P1.0 P1.7 :P1 口 8 位双向口线。 P2.0 P2.7 :P2 口 8 位双向口线。 P3.0 P3.7 :P3 口 8 位双向口线。4 XTAL1 和 XTAL2:外接晶振引脚。当使用外部振荡器时,外部振荡信号应直接加到 XTAL1,而 XTAL2 悬空。5 控制引脚:ALE/-PROG、-PSEN、-EA/Vpp 组成了 MSC-51 的控制总线。(1) -EA/Vpp(31 脚):外部程序存储器地址允许输入端。第二功能:固化编程电压输入端。(2) ALE/-PROG(30 脚):地址锁存允许信号端。第二功能:编程脉冲输入端。(3) -PSEN(29 脚):程序存储允许输出信号端。